In average, 69% of full-time first-time beginning undergraduate students (freshmen) have received grants and/or scholarships at most-searched-technical-colleges-in-new-hampshire. The average financial aid amount received is $8,546.
For all undergraduate students, 66.83% received grants/scholarship and the average aid amount is $7,531
The 2024 average tuition & fees for the schools is $9,683 for state residents and $21,899 for out-of-state students.
The average cost of attendance (COA) including tuition & fees, book & supplies, and living costs for most-searched-technical-colleges-in-new-hampshire is $39,218 and, after receiving financial aid, the actual cost is down to $30,672.
